When Is It Time to Consider Solar Panel Removal and Replacement?

Older solar systems, particularly those installed before 2015, often use panels with efficiencies of 14–17%, compared to modern panels achieving 20–22% or higher. Over time, panels can degrade (typically 0.5–1% per year), suffer from micro-cracks, hot spots, or PID (potential-induced degradation), leading to noticeably lower output.

Common signs that replacement may be beneficial include:

  • Reduced Energy Production: Monitoring data or higher-than-expected bills despite good weather.
  • Visible Damage: Cracked glass, delamination, browning, or corrosion — especially common in coastal Sunshine Coast conditions.
  • Desire for Battery Integration: Many legacy systems weren’t designed for storage, making upgrades essential for adding batteries.
  • End of Warranty Period: Most early panels carried 25-year performance warranties that are now approaching maturity.

Replacing rather than repairing often makes financial sense, especially with current incentives and rapidly improving technology.

Our Off-Grid Solar and Battery Installation Process

Safety, efficiency, and minimal disruption are our priorities when removing and replacing existing solar systems. The process typically follows these steps:

  1. Initial Assessment: We inspect your current system, review performance history, and discuss your energy goals and budget.
  2. System Shutdown and Isolation: The existing setup is safely de-energised and isolated in compliance with Australian electrical standards.
  3. Careful Panel Removal: Old panels are detached from racking, with care taken to avoid roof damage. Wiring and conduits are labelled for reference.
  4. Roof and Racking Inspection: We check the underlying structure and racking. Reusable components are retained; damaged or outdated parts are replaced.
  5. Responsible Disposal and Recycling: Removed panels are handled through accredited recycling partners to recover valuable materials and minimise environmental impact.
  6. New System Installation: Modern panels, optimised racking (if needed) and optional battery storage are installed using best-practice techniques.
  7. Testing and Recommissioning: The upgraded system is thoroughly tested, reconnected to the grid, and brought online.
  8. Handover and Monitoring Setup: You receive full documentation, warranty details, and guidance on monitoring your improved performance.

Most domestic replacements can be completed in 1–3 days, with commercial and industrial projects scheduled to suit operational requirements.

Financial Benefits and Available Incentives

Upgrading an existing system can still attract valuable support:

  • Small-scale Technology Certificates (STCs): New replacement systems under 100kW remain eligible for STCs, providing a substantial upfront discount based on system size and location zone (favourable for the Sunshine Coast).
  • Battery Incentives: Adding storage during replacement may qualify for federal programs offering approximately 30% discount on eligible batteries through initiatives like the Cheaper Home Batteries Program (current as of late 2025).
  • Improved Return on Investment: Higher-efficiency panels generate more electricity from the same roof space, shortening payback periods despite the upgrade cost.

Many clients find that the increased output and available incentives make replacement more cost-effective than continuing with an underperforming older system.

Questions About Solar Panel Removal and Replacement

Will removing old panels damage my roof? No — our team uses careful techniques and checks roof integrity throughout the process. Any minor issues are addressed before reinstallation.

What happens to my old panels? They are recycled through certified partners, recovering silicon, glass, and metals responsibly.

Can I keep my existing racking? Often yes, if it’s in good condition and compatible. We assess and upgrade only what’s necessary.

How long will the new system last? Modern panels are warrantied for 25–30 years, with expected lifespans exceeding 35 years.

Do I lose incentives because I already had solar? No — replacement systems qualify for current STCs and battery incentives as new installations.
